CVE-2025-6533
Auth Bypass in Xxyopen Novel-Plus ≤ 5.1.3

CVE-2025-6533 is a low-severity Improper Authentication (CWE-287) vulnerability in Xxyopen Novel-Plus. Its CVSS base score is 2.9 (Low).
Operationally, exploitation aligns with the MITRE ATT&CK technique Brute Force (T1110); ranked at the 39th percentile by exploit likelihood (below the median); it is not currently listed in the CISA KEV catalog; a public proof-of-concept is referenced.

Vulnerability Data
A vulnerability, which was classified as critical, has been found in xxyopen/201206030 novel-plus up to 5.1.3. Affected by this issue is the function ajaxLogin of the file novel-admin/src/main/java/com/java2nb/system/controller/LoginController.java of the component CATCHA Handler. The manipulation leads to authentication bypass by…

capture-replay. The attack may be launched remotely. The complexity of an attack is rather high. The exploitation is known to be difficult. The exploit has been disclosed to the public and may be used. The vendor was contacted early about this disclosure but did not respond in any way.
